      I came here after my hearty Puerto Rican meal. A bowl of fro-yo is not a bad treat after any meal. Agree?

      I enjoyed eating at Tuttimelon and I think every U.S. city should have at least one or ten Tuttimelon shop(s). Hopefully my request may come true within the next few years.

      This Downtown location is one of the smallest shop of the chain. When you think of the crowd dining at most Tuttimelons, you think of an Asian community. But this North Bay location has primarily families coming here afterschool, after baseball practice or bringing their kid(s) in their double-strollers on a warm weekend.

      Upon my reasonable visit, there are four flavors:

      -Original Tart (of course)
      -Strawberry Tart
      -Chocolate
      -Peach

      There are no specials at this location. So for $2.95, I get a five-ounce bowl of Peach. And for an additional $.95, I get the chewy Mochi balls as my lone topping. Peach is the top fruit of the summer and the peach flavored fro-yo tasted creamy and very sweet with good flavor. And the peach flavor is NOW my favorite fro-yo flavor from Tuttimelon.

      If any fro-yo shops can top Tuttimelon's Peach flavor, I don't think it can be possible.

      Wowie Zowie! It's been a loooooong time since I've tasted Gelato this good!!!! Gelato is just a fancy Italian name for ice cream, but at Tuttimelon, the emphasis is on FANCY!

      I first spotted Tuttimelon last week after surviving a grueling hike in the hills surrounding San Rafael. Sadly, I had forgotten my wallet, and I would have felt uncomfortable to have gone in only for tastes and not purchased anything, so I waited until I had the cash to peruse and indulge my sense.

      That being said, if I had gone in for tastes without my wallet, I would have probably been forced to rob the nearest bank in order to sate my tastebuds once I had tasted the savoury offerings! This place is a remarkable, tucked-away treasure, longing to be discovered.

      This afternoon, I had a friend tag along and when we walked in, we were both impressed with the Jetsonian-style bar stools and chairs reminiscent fo the 60's. The main wall is waved in undulating white crests, anchored by transparent glass tiles in greens and blues. Classy staging!

      The gelato and sorbet (think vegan), offerings (24 in all) are displayed in a freezer case, beckoning all to partake and indulge. Some of the flavours were relatively common, but among the more unusual were pumpkin pie, cookies and cream and royal burgandy cherry, but the most unusual flavors that caught my eye were honey lavender and caramel balsamic.

      I asked for a sample (limit of two) of the honey lavender and immediately I was in love! Imagine a gelato treat with the main ingredient being the nectar of the gods, infused with the essence of lavender. G-rated words cannot describe the tantalising essence!

      I next asked for a sample of the caramel balsamic. What an unusual combination and yet, it is a stunningly orchestrated blend of caramel with a hint of balsamic vinegar that will send your senses reeling. Wow! Where's the bread?

      And if that were not enought, eight fresh fruit and fifteen confectionary toppings are offered to compliment and customize your choice. When you become a regular customer, they have a stamp card; buy eight and get one small yogurt free with two toppings.

      Finally, as I finished my notes, I interviewed the manager. He said his store has been open for six months and Tuttimelon has expanded to six franchises in the Bay area. He humbly declined to give his name, identifying himself only as the Anonymous Manager of Tuttimelon of San Rafael.

      But, he told me that gelatos and sorbets are not what started this company. He said it was the yogurt, and with that, he offered me a taste of their signature yougurt, a fresh, indulgent, whisp with hint of lemon. Wow again! Now THIS is what the gods feast upon.

      As I walk into this visually stunning parlor, I feel as though I am in Miami or South Beach. Half inch sized light ocean blue tiles cover the lower half of the wall then the upper half of the wall has a plaster of white waves. Nice! What is not to love about that and the recessed lighting, and the fabulous orange and white chairs, pristine white tables and the columns done in 1/2 inch tiles again, but in the hues of greens and browns. Oh yes, and the Neon Green back wall that ties this all in. The creative touch of one fresh lemon on each table, did NOT go unnoticed! This in Marin? WOW.

      Ok, on to the scrumptuous goodies. There are over 24 Gelatos and they rotate out with other flavors. Creme Brulee, divine. Pistachio, meow!

      The yogurts are mouth puckering fabulous. My favorite is the pomegranate with fresh mango topping.

      They usually have 4 flavors of yogurts as well. Plus they have a myriad of toppings. From crumpled cookies, candies, granola, to delicious fresh fruit.

      Their granola is house made, and they have a nice selection of organic teas. Plus smoothies and Yoggi drinks. All this, reasonably priced.

      They have the nicest wait staff to boot!

      What a wonderful addition to San Rafael. I was getting sad with so many businesses closing down on 4th. But this gem, makes me have a new sense of confidence for this sometimes weary town.
